Garlic-Derived S-Allylmercaptocysteine Ameliorates Nonalcoholic Fatty Liver Disease in a Rat Model through Inhibition of Apoptosis and Enhancing Autophagy
Figure 1
Cotreatment with SAMC during NAFLD development improved hepatic histology in rats. ((a)–(d)) Representative images of H&E staining in the rat liver sections ((a) control, (b) NAFLD, (c) SAMC, (d) NAFLD + SAMC) and (e) quantitative data of NAS score of H&E staining. Data presented are expressed as Mean ± SEM () and experimental groups marked by different letters represented significant differences between groups at (Kruskal-Wallis test followed by Dunn’s post hoc test). Magnification: 200x. Bar: 20 microns. N + S: NAFLD + SAMC cotreatment.
